Salmon Region Fishing Information
#1
The summer temperatures have turned the fishing on near Challis. The trout fishing at Mosquito Flats Reservoir and Bayhorse Lake has slowed a little bit because the fish are going deeper with the warmer weather; however worms and bobbers are working well. Fly fishing is really coming on and as the water drops, it keeps getting better. Mackay Reservoir is good for trolling deep.


<br>The Salmon River is near normal flows now and the trout fishing is excellent. Anglers are catching lots of fish at the kid's ponds and lakes on the valley floor. And the high mountain lakes are open and also fishing well.<br>

<br>The lake fishing is good at recently stocked Wallace and Meadow Lakes. The public sections of the Lemhi River are extremely good with anglers reporting excellent results with both fly and spinning rods. Williams Lake is fishing well with top water flies, eggs and worms. Hayden Ponds near Lemhi report good fishing but the water is very mossy and will probably remain that way until cool fall weather.
